吃鸡游戏加密技术解析,从基础到高级玩吃鸡游戏怎么加密啊

吃鸡游戏加密技术解析,从基础到高级玩吃鸡游戏怎么加密啊,

本文目录导读:

  1. 什么是加密技术?
  2. 《吃鸡》游戏中的加密技术
  3. 《吃鸡》游戏中的加密技术实现
  4. 《吃鸡》游戏加密技术的优势
  5. 《吃鸡》游戏加密技术的未来发展方向

什么是加密技术?

加密技术是一种通过数学算法对数据进行编码,使其无法被未经授权的访问者解密的方法,在游戏开发中,加密技术可以用于保护游戏数据、防止数据泄露、防止外挂,以及确保玩家隐私。

对称加密

对称加密是一种使用相同密钥对数据进行加密和解密的算法,常见的对称加密算法包括AES、 DES、 Blowfish等,对称加密速度快、效率高,适合用于加密敏感数据。

非对称加密

非对称加密使用不同的密钥对数据进行加密和解密,公钥用于加密,私钥用于解密,常见的非对称加密算法包括RSA、 ECC等,非对称加密安全性高,但加密和解密速度较慢。

加密协议

在游戏通信中,常用的加密协议包括TLS/SSL、 Wickman等,这些协议可以确保游戏数据在传输过程中不被窃取。


《吃鸡》游戏中的加密技术

数据加密

在《吃鸡》游戏中,玩家的个人信息、武器配置、游戏数据等都需要进行加密,以下是一些常见的数据加密方法:

(1)玩家数据加密

玩家数据包括玩家的ID、位置、武器类型、剩余弹药等,这些数据可以通过对称加密进行加密,因为这些数据通常不会涉及高度敏感的内容。

(2)游戏数据加密

游戏数据包括地图数据、敌人数据、资源数据等,这些数据可以通过非对称加密进行加密,以确保数据的安全性。

(3)通信数据加密

玩家之间的消息(如“开火”、“求救”等)需要通过加密协议进行加密,以防止被中间人窃取。

通信加密

在《吃鸡》游戏中,通信数据的加密非常重要,以下是通信加密的常见方法:

(1)TLS/SSL协议

TLS/SSL协议是一种用于加密通信的数据传输协议,通过TLS/SSL协议,玩家之间的消息可以被加密,防止被中间人窃取。

(2)Wickman协议

Wickman协议是一种专为游戏设计的通信协议,它可以在不引入额外开销的情况下实现端到端加密。

(3)端到端加密

端到端加密是一种通过加密通信链路,确保消息在传输过程中不被窃取的方法,在《吃鸡》游戏中,端到端加密可以防止中间人窃取玩家的隐私信息。

访问控制

为了确保玩家的隐私和游戏数据的安全,需要对玩家的访问权限进行控制,以下是访问控制的常见方法:

(1)基于权限的访问控制(RBAC)

RBAC是一种通过赋予玩家不同的权限来控制玩家访问游戏资源的方法,管理员可以控制玩家是否可以查看地图、获取武器等。

(2)基于角色的访问控制(RBAC)

RBAC是一种通过赋予玩家不同的角色来控制玩家访问游戏资源的方法,管理员可以控制玩家是否可以成为“潜行者”或“狙击手”。

(3)身份验证

身份验证是一种通过验证玩家的身份来控制玩家访问游戏资源的方法,管理员可以通过密码或生物识别来验证玩家的身份。


《吃鸡》游戏中的加密技术实现

数据加密的实现

在《吃鸡》游戏中,数据加密可以通过以下步骤实现:

(1)选择加密算法

选择合适的加密算法是实现数据加密的关键,对于敏感数据(如玩家ID、武器配置等),可以使用AES算法;对于非敏感数据(如地图数据、敌人数据等),可以使用RSA算法。

(2)生成密钥

生成密钥是实现数据加密的必要步骤,密钥的长度和强度直接影响数据的安全性,建议使用256位的密钥。

(3)加密数据

使用加密算法对数据进行加密,生成加密数据。

(4)存储加密数据

将加密数据存储在游戏服务器中。

(5)解密数据

在玩家连接到游戏时,从游戏服务器获取加密数据,并使用密钥对数据进行解密。

通信加密的实现

在《吃鸡》游戏中,通信加密可以通过以下步骤实现:

(1)选择加密协议

选择合适的加密协议是实现通信加密的关键,可以使用TLS/SSL协议或Wickman协议。

(2)加密消息

使用加密协议对玩家消息进行加密,生成加密消息。

(3)传输加密消息

将加密消息传输给其他玩家。

(4)解密消息

在玩家连接到游戏时,从其他玩家处获取加密消息,并使用密钥对消息进行解密。

访问控制的实现

在《吃鸡》游戏中,访问控制可以通过以下步骤实现:

(1)定义访问权限

定义玩家的访问权限,例如是否可以查看地图、获取武器等。

(2)验证玩家身份

验证玩家的身份,例如是否需要管理员权限才能创建角色。

(3)控制玩家访问

根据玩家的权限,控制玩家访问游戏资源。

(4)日志记录

记录玩家的访问日志,以防止未经授权的访问。


《吃鸡》游戏加密技术的优势

提高安全性

通过加密技术,可以有效防止数据泄露、防止外挂和滥用游戏资源。

保护玩家隐私

通过加密技术,可以保护玩家的隐私,防止其他玩家窃取玩家的敏感信息。

提高游戏体验

通过加密技术,可以确保游戏通信的稳定性和安全性,提升玩家的游戏体验。


《吃鸡》游戏加密技术的未来发展方向

引入零知识证明

零知识证明是一种通过数学方法证明某件事是真的,而无需透露任何额外信息的方法,在《吃鸡》游戏中,零知识证明可以用于验证玩家的资格,而无需透露玩家的任何敏感信息。

实现游戏的可验证性

通过引入可验证性技术,可以确保游戏的公平性和公正性,可以使用区块链技术来记录游戏的每一步,以防止玩家作弊。

提高游戏的可玩性

通过引入新的加密技术,可以提高游戏的可玩性,例如允许玩家自定义游戏规则和加密参数。


《吃鸡》游戏加密技术是确保游戏安全性和玩家隐私的重要手段,通过对称加密、非对称加密、TLS/SSL协议、Wickman协议、RBAC、身份验证等技术,可以有效防止数据泄露、防止外挂和滥用游戏资源,随着加密技术的发展,游戏的安全性将不断提高,玩家的隐私将得到更好的保护。

吃鸡游戏加密技术解析,从基础到高级玩吃鸡游戏怎么加密啊,

发表评论